Zbigniew Jędrzejewski-Szmek 117843fe95 network: make DEFINE_NETDEV_CAST() assert on input and output
The macro used to return NULL if input was NULL or had the wrong type. Now
it asserts that input is nonnull and it has the expected type.

There are a few places where a missing or mismatched type was OK, but in a
majority of places, we would do both of the asserts. In various places we'd
only do one, but that was by ommission/mistake. So moving the asserts into the
macro allows us to save some lines.

/* SPDX-License-Identifier: LGPL-2.1-or-later */
#include <linux/can/vxcan.h>
#include <linux/if_arp.h>
#include "vxcan.h"
static int netdev_vxcan_fill_message_create(NetDev *netdev, Link *link, sd_netlink_message *m) {
assert(!link);
assert(m);
VxCan *v = VXCAN(netdev);
int r;
r = sd_netlink_message_open_container(m, VXCAN_INFO_PEER);
if (r < 0)
return r;
if (v->ifname_peer) {
r = sd_netlink_message_append_string(m, IFLA_IFNAME, v->ifname_peer);
if (r < 0)
return r;
}
r = sd_netlink_message_close_container(m);
if (r < 0)
return r;
return 0;
}
static int netdev_vxcan_verify(NetDev *netdev, const char *filename) {
assert(filename);
VxCan *v = VXCAN(netdev);
if (!v->ifname_peer)
return log_netdev_warning_errno(netdev, SYNTHETIC_ERRNO(EINVAL),
"VxCan NetDev without peer name configured in %s. Ignoring", filename);
return 0;
}
static void vxcan_done(NetDev *netdev) {
VxCan *v = VXCAN(netdev);
free(v->ifname_peer);
}
const NetDevVTable vxcan_vtable = {
.object_size = sizeof(VxCan),
.sections = NETDEV_COMMON_SECTIONS "VXCAN\0",
.done = vxcan_done,
.fill_message_create = netdev_vxcan_fill_message_create,
.create_type = NETDEV_CREATE_INDEPENDENT,
.config_verify = netdev_vxcan_verify,
.iftype = ARPHRD_CAN,
};
